<p>LIkeLock is not an insurance company, nor do they claim to be one. If I were you, I would be very skeptical about companies that refer to their identity theft protection services as insurance. Companies selling insurance are subject to state and federal licensing and regulations similar to those of banks, and it&#8217;s highly doubtful that the ID theft services companies you&#8217;re talking about are legitimate.</p>
<p>LifeLock&#8217;s $1 million total service guarantee backs up their product and is based on the same simple premise of other guarantees we&#8217;re all familiar with: If we sell you a defective product, we&#8217;ll honor our responsibility. In the case of a defective washing machine, the company will service the appliance or replace it. If there is a defect in LifeLock&#8217;s service that results in a member&#8217;s identity theft, LifeLock will spend up to $1 million to help in the repair and recovery efforts.</p>

I&#8217;ve been researching and writing about ID theft full time for almost 3 years, and have never heard or read anything about stolen emails. I&#8217;ve heard the stuff about their $1million service. It is limited because it&#8217;s impossible to completely prevent ID theft&#8211;there are hundreds of stories about identities stolen by bank, hospital, insurance employees and recently one about an AT&amp;T temp who stole info. According to a VerizonBusiness study, more than 280 MILLION records were compromised in data breaches in 2008. If you read of a service that claims to PREVENT ID theft, run! What LifeLock provides in a service that helps their members protect themselves, catch the incident early and move on through damage control.</p>
